Description

- Phone and email-based support with advanced training in supporting adoptive, foster, and kinship families - Connects families with adoption/trauma/attachment-competent therapists, appropriate community resources, and educational offerings - Assists eligible families with funding to help with the cost of therapy with HELP Program vetted therapists, Foster Adopt Minnesota educational offerings, and eligible supports

Providing organization

Foster Adopt Minnesota

Provides information, education, and support to the Minnesota adoption, foster care, and kinship communities with the goal of promoting and supporting successful adoptions.
